Transaction 2414446e31bbc492a0d3326f32cba766a57822d1297f7c1f94e395090c15d876

5 Input
2 Outputs
  • 2414446e31bbc492a0d3326f32cba766a57822d1297f7c1f94e395090c15d876:0
  • value  22330497
    address  1KMwwZ5FCHxf1UBTEQynUNVZmCQDa4RTRU
  • 2414446e31bbc492a0d3326f32cba766a57822d1297f7c1f94e395090c15d876:1
  • value  1583340
    address  bc1qghue22997h5hl6skpxzll86ne62x59g00jsu69